
Magic mushrooms, scientifically known as psilocybin mushrooms, are a group of fungi that contain the psychoactive compound psilocybin. When growing in their natural habitat, these mushrooms typically appear as small to medium-sized fungi with slender stems and caps that can range in color from light tan to dark brown, often with a distinctive conical or bell-like shape. The caps may have a smooth or slightly wrinkled texture and can sometimes develop a bluish-green hue when bruised or aged, due to the oxidation of psilocybin. They are commonly found in grassy areas, meadows, and woodlands, particularly in regions with rich, organic soil and a temperate climate. Identifying them requires careful observation, as their appearance can vary slightly between species, and they may resemble other non-psychoactive mushrooms, making proper knowledge essential for accurate recognition.

Cap Characteristics: Conical to bell-shaped, often golden-brown, with smooth or striated edges
When identifying magic mushrooms in their natural habitat, one of the most distinctive features to look for is the cap characteristics. The caps of these fungi typically exhibit a conical to bell-shaped structure, especially in younger specimens. As the mushroom matures, the cap may flatten slightly, but it often retains a pronounced central bump or umbo, giving it a bell-like appearance. This shape is a key identifier, setting them apart from other mushroom species that may have more rounded, flat, or irregular caps. Observing the cap’s shape from various angles can help confirm its conical or bell-like form, which is crucial for accurate identification.
The color of the cap is another critical feature. Magic mushrooms often display a golden-brown hue, though this can vary from pale tan to deep brown depending on the species and environmental conditions. The golden-brown shade is particularly prominent in species like *Psilocybe cubensis*, one of the most well-known magic mushrooms. This coloration can sometimes appear slightly iridescent or fade to a lighter tone when exposed to direct sunlight. It’s important to note that the cap’s color may darken or lighten as the mushroom ages, so context and other characteristics should also be considered.
The edges of the cap provide additional clues for identification. They are typically smooth or striated, meaning they may have fine, radial lines or grooves that become more visible when the cap is moist. These striations occur because the cap tissue stretches as the mushroom grows, causing the surface to crack slightly. In drier conditions, the edges may appear smoother and less pronounced. Striated edges are a common feature in many *Psilocybe* species and can help distinguish them from mushrooms with finely toothed or wavy edges.
When examining the cap, pay attention to its texture and consistency. The surface is usually smooth to the touch, lacking any significant bumps, scales, or hairs. However, under magnification, you might notice a fine, granular texture. The cap’s flesh is generally thin and pliable, especially in younger mushrooms, but it can become slightly tougher as the fungus matures. This combination of texture and consistency, along with the shape and color, helps narrow down the identification to magic mushrooms.
Finally, the size of the cap is worth noting. In most magic mushroom species, the cap diameter ranges from 1 to 5 centimeters, though this can vary. Younger mushrooms will have smaller, more conical caps, while mature specimens may have larger, more open bell-shaped caps. The size, combined with the golden-brown color, smooth or striated edges, and overall shape, creates a distinctive profile that can aid in recognizing these fungi in their growing environment. Always cross-reference these cap characteristics with other features, such as the stem and gills, to ensure accurate identification.

Stem Features: Slender, whitish, sometimes bluish bruises, hollow or partially filled
When identifying magic mushrooms in their natural habitat, one of the most distinctive features to look for is the stem, which plays a crucial role in distinguishing them from other fungi. The stem of magic mushrooms is typically slender, often appearing delicate and elongated compared to the cap. This slender characteristic is consistent across many species, such as *Psilocybe cubensis*, one of the most commonly encountered varieties. The stem’s diameter is usually uniform or slightly thicker at the base, but it never appears robust or bulbous like some non-psilocybin mushrooms.
The coloration of the stem is another key feature. It is predominantly whitish or pale in hue, which contrasts with the often darker or more vibrant colors of the cap. This whitish tone can vary slightly depending on the species and environmental conditions, but it generally remains consistent. One unique aspect to note is the presence of bluish bruises on the stem. When the stem is handled or damaged, it may develop blue or bluish-green discoloration due to the oxidation of psilocin, a compound found in magic mushrooms. This bruising is a strong indicator of the mushroom’s psychoactive properties and is a critical identification feature.
The internal structure of the stem is equally important. Upon examination, you’ll find that the stem is either hollow or partially filled. This feature can be observed by gently breaking or cutting the stem open. A hollow stem is more common, but some species may have a partially filled or pithy interior. This characteristic helps differentiate magic mushrooms from other fungi that often have solid or fibrous stems. The hollowness also contributes to the mushroom’s overall lightweight and fragile appearance.
When observing magic mushrooms growing in the wild, pay close attention to how the stem interacts with the cap. The stem is usually centrally attached to the cap, and its slender, whitish appearance provides a stark contrast to the often brown or golden hues of the cap. The presence of bluish bruises, especially after handling, further confirms the mushroom’s identity. Additionally, the stem’s texture is typically smooth or slightly fibrous, without prominent ridges or scales, which can aid in identification.
In summary, the stem of magic mushrooms is a slender, whitish structure that may exhibit bluish bruises when damaged. Its hollow or partially filled interior is a defining feature, setting it apart from other fungi. These characteristics, combined with its smooth texture and central attachment to the cap, are essential for accurately identifying magic mushrooms in their natural environment. Gills Underneath: Gills are closely spaced, purple-brown, attached to stem
When identifying magic mushrooms, particularly those of the *Psilocybe* genus, one of the most distinctive features to look for is the gills underneath the cap. These gills are not only crucial for spore production but also serve as a key characteristic for identification. In the case of magic mushrooms, the gills are typically closely spaced, giving them a dense and almost crowded appearance. This spacing is important to note, as it distinguishes them from other mushroom species that may have gills that are more spread out. The close spacing creates a fine, intricate pattern that can be observed with the naked eye, though a magnifying glass can provide a clearer view.
The color of the gills is another critical feature. In magic mushrooms, the gills are often purple-brown, especially in mature specimens. This coloration can vary slightly depending on the species and age of the mushroom, but the purple-brown hue is a common and reliable indicator. Younger mushrooms may have lighter gills that darken as they mature, eventually developing the characteristic purple-brown shade. This color is a result of the spores and the mushroom's natural pigments, making it a key trait to look for when identifying these fungi in the wild.
The attachment of the gills to the stem is another important aspect to consider. In magic mushrooms, the gills are attached to the stem, often in a manner described as adnate or adnexed. This means the gills curve upward and are broadly attached to the stem, rather than being free or narrowly attached. This attachment style is consistent across many *Psilocybe* species and helps differentiate them from other mushrooms with different gill attachments. Observing this feature requires gently lifting the cap to examine the point where the gills meet the stem.
When examining magic mushrooms growing in their natural habitat, it’s essential to observe these gill characteristics in conjunction with other features, such as the cap shape, color, and overall size. The closely spaced, purple-brown gills attached to the stem are a telltale sign, but they should be confirmed with other identifying traits to ensure accuracy. Foraging for magic mushrooms should always be done with caution and, ideally, under the guidance of an experienced mycologist, as misidentification can lead to serious consequences. Understanding these gill features is a fundamental step in recognizing these unique and fascinating fungi.

Growing Environment: Found in grassy fields, woodlands, on dung or rich soil
Magic mushrooms, scientifically known as *Psilocybe* species, thrive in specific environments that provide the right balance of moisture, nutrients, and organic matter. One of the most common places to find them is in grassy fields, particularly those that are undisturbed and rich in decaying vegetation. These fields often serve as ideal habitats because they offer a soft, nutrient-dense substrate where the mycelium (the vegetative part of the fungus) can spread easily. Look for areas with tall grass or meadows that receive partial sunlight, as magic mushrooms prefer indirect light. The grass itself acts as both a camouflage and a source of organic material, supporting the mushrooms' growth cycle.
Woodlands are another prime location for spotting magic mushrooms, especially in temperate and subtropical regions. These fungi often grow at the base of trees, where leaf litter and decaying wood provide a rich, humus-like soil. Species like *Psilocybe cubensis* and *Psilocybe semilanceata* are frequently found in forests with deciduous trees, where the fallen leaves create a moist, nutrient-rich environment. The shade provided by the canopy helps maintain the humidity levels these mushrooms need to flourish. When exploring woodlands, pay attention to clusters of mushrooms growing in circular patterns, known as "fairy rings," which indicate the presence of mycelium beneath the soil.
Magic mushrooms also have a peculiar affinity for dung, particularly that of herbivorous animals like cows and horses. This is because dung provides a readily available source of nitrogen and other essential nutrients that the fungi require to grow. In pastures or fields where livestock graze, you may find *Psilocybe* species sprouting directly from animal droppings. This environment is particularly favorable for species like *Psilocybe mexicana* and *Psilocybe tampanensis*. The warmth and moisture retained by the dung create an ideal microclimate for rapid mushroom growth, often resulting in dense clusters of fruiting bodies.
In addition to dung, magic mushrooms are frequently found in rich soil, especially in areas with high organic content. This includes garden beds, compost piles, and well-fertilized lawns. The key factor here is the presence of decomposing organic matter, which releases nutrients into the soil and supports fungal growth. When searching in these areas, look for mushrooms with slender stems and conical or bell-shaped caps, often with a distinctive bluish or greenish hue at the base due to psilocin oxidation. The soil should be moist but well-drained, as waterlogged conditions can hinder growth.
Understanding these growing environments is crucial for identifying magic mushrooms in the wild. Whether in grassy fields, woodlands, on dung, or in rich soil, these fungi are highly adaptable but require specific conditions to thrive. Always remember to properly identify mushrooms before handling or consuming them, as many toxic species resemble *Psilocybe* varieties. Observing their habitat can provide valuable clues to their identity, but verification through spore prints or expert guidance is essential for safety.

Spores and Veil: Dark spores, partial veil leaves ring on stem
When identifying magic mushrooms in their growing stage, one of the key features to look for is the spores and veil, particularly when the mushroom exhibits dark spores and a partial veil that leaves a ring on the stem. This characteristic is crucial for distinguishing certain species, such as *Psilocybe cubensis*, a common type of magic mushroom. The partial veil is a thin, membrane-like structure that connects the cap of the mushroom to its stem during the early stages of growth. As the mushroom matures, the cap expands, breaking the veil, and often leaving a distinct ring around the upper part of the stem. This ring, known as the annulus, is a telltale sign of a partial veil.
The dark spores are another critical identifier. Magic mushrooms typically produce spores that range from dark purple to black-brown. These spores are released from the gills located on the underside of the cap. When examining a mature mushroom, you may notice a dusty, dark residue on surfaces beneath the cap, which is the result of spore drop. To observe spores more closely, you can place the cap gill-side down on a piece of paper or glass overnight, allowing the spores to fall and form a pattern known as a spore print. This print will be a deep, dark color, consistent with the spore description.
The development of the partial veil is a fascinating process. Initially, the veil envelops the gills to protect them during the mushroom’s early growth stages. As the cap expands, the veil tears, but in species with a partial veil, a portion of it remains attached to the stem, forming the annulus. This ring is often fragile and can be easily brushed off, but its presence is a reliable indicator of the mushroom’s developmental stage and species. When foraging, look for this ring as a distinguishing feature, especially in younger specimens where the cap may still be partially veiled.
In the context of magic mushrooms, the combination of dark spores and a partial veil ring is particularly significant. These features are consistent across many *Psilocybe* species, making them important for identification. However, it’s essential to approach foraging with caution, as misidentification can lead to dangerous consequences. Always cross-reference multiple characteristics, such as cap color, gill attachment, and habitat, to ensure accurate identification. The dark spores and veil ring are valuable clues, but they should be considered alongside other traits for a comprehensive assessment.
Finally, observing these mushrooms in their natural habitat can provide additional insights. Magic mushrooms often grow in woody, fibrous, or manure-rich environments, such as pastures, meadows, or forests. The presence of dark spores and a partial veil ring, combined with the typical habitat, can strengthen your identification. Remember, while these features are instructive, they are part of a broader set of characteristics that must be evaluated together. Always prioritize safety and legality when studying or foraging for magic mushrooms.

Magic mushrooms, scientifically known as Psilocybe species, typically have a slender stem, a cap with a convex to flat shape, and gills underneath the cap. The cap often has a smooth or slightly scaly texture and can range in color from light brown to dark brown or even golden.
Some species of magic mushrooms, like Psilocybe cubensis, may have a slight bluish or greenish bruising when damaged due to the oxidation of psilocin. However, they do not naturally glow in the dark or have other distinctive visual features that make them easily identifiable without close inspection.
Magic mushrooms vary in size depending on the species and growing conditions. On average, the cap diameter ranges from 1 to 5 centimeters (0.4 to 2 inches), and the stem height can be between 5 to 12 centimeters (2 to 5 inches).
Magic mushrooms are often found in moist, humid environments, such as grassy fields, meadows, forests, and areas with decaying organic matter like wood chips or manure. They thrive in temperate and tropical climates.
Distinguishing magic mushrooms requires careful observation of features like cap shape, gill color, stem structure, and bruising reactions. However, positive identification should only be done by an experienced mycologist, as many toxic mushrooms resemble magic mushrooms. When in doubt, avoid consumption.
